The Bredolab botnet is stubbornly clinging to life even after having its herder arrested in Armenia and 143 of its command servers knocked offline. A Scottish man has pleaded guilty to his role in a cybercrime ring. Authorities say Matthew Anderson used spam to distribute malware designed to steal financial information. His scheme, which began in 2005, targeted UK businesses.

Russian police have announced they have opened an investigation of a man they are calling a spam king. 33 year old Igor Gusev is accused of being responsible for up to 20% of all Viagra and prescription drug spam.

The infamous phishing gang known as Avalanche has turned to the Zeus botnet to help boost their profits and diversify their activities.
